Why AI Agents Pose a New Security Threat
As organizations increasingly deploy AI agents capable of decision-making, communication, and infrastructure interaction, the attack surface expands exponentially. According to Gartner®, by 2028, a quarter of all enterprise data breaches will stem from AI agent exploitation — both by external attackers and malicious insiders.
Unlike static machine identities or predictable human accounts, AI agents are dynamic, self-learning, and capable of growing in autonomy. This makes managing their identities, access permissions, and behavior a complex challenge that demands a multi-layered security approach.
CyberArk’s Identity-First Defense Strategy
CyberArk’s solution treats each AI agent as a privileged identity, ensuring real-time discovery, oversight, and adaptive control. The platform’s advanced capabilities include:
- Agent Discovery & Contextual Awareness: Continuous visibility into both authorized and shadow agents operating across SaaS platforms, infrastructure, and internal systems.
- Granular Privilege Controls: Enforces least-privilege access, manages credentials like secrets and certificates, and controls escalation pathways.
- Threat Detection & Response: Behavioral monitoring to detect anomalies, prevent privilege abuse, and stop identity drift.
- Automated Lifecycle Management: Seamlessly provisions and decommissions AI agents as needed, eliminating dormant or excessive access rights.
- Governance & Compliance: Ensures all agents operate within regulatory and organizational policy frameworks.
Open-Source Tools for Developers
Alongside the enterprise solution, CyberArk introduced the AI Agent Tool Set — a new open-source toolkit available via GitHub. Aimed at developers, this resource provides visibility into how AI agents interact, flags vulnerabilities, and offers features like just-in-time credential provisioning to optimize both security and development efficiency.
Supporting the solution is CORA AI™, CyberArk’s embedded AI engine that enhances security across the platform. CORA AI analyzes behaviors, detects real-time threats, suggests automated remediation, and allows administrators to interact with the system using natural language commands — simplifying operations and accelerating incident response.
